作为一名程序员,我们经常会遇到需要将Excel文件转换成JSP页面以供Web展示的情况。这个过程虽然看似繁琐,但其实只要掌握了正确的方法,就可以轻松完成。今天,我就来和大家分享一下如何将Excel转成JSP实例的详细步骤。
准备工作
在进行Excel转JSP之前,我们需要做好以下准备工作:

1. 开发环境:确保你的电脑上已经安装了Java开发环境,如JDK等。
2. 数据库:准备一个数据库,如MySQL、Oracle等,用于存储Excel文件中的数据。
3. IDE:选择一个适合自己的IDE,如Eclipse、IntelliJ IDEA等,以便于进行Java开发。
步骤一:Excel文件数据提取
我们需要从Excel文件中提取数据。这里我们以Apache POI库为例,它是一个非常强大的Java库,可以轻松地操作Excel文件。
1. 添加依赖
在你的项目中的pom.xml文件中添加以下依赖:
```xml
```
2. 读取Excel文件
接下来,我们编写一个Java类来读取Excel文件:
```java
import org.apache.poi.ss.usermodel.*;
import java.io.FileInputStream;
import java.io.IOException;
public class ExcelReader {
public static void readExcel(String filePath) throws IOException {
FileInputStream fis = new FileInputStream(filePath);
Workbook workbook = WorkbookFactory.create(fis);
Sheet sheet = workbook.getSheetAt(0);
Row row;
for (int i = 0; i <= sheet.getLastRowNum(); i++) {
row = sheet.getRow(i);
if (row != null) {
// 获取单元格数据
String cellValue = row.getCell(0).getStringCellValue();
// 处理数据...
}
}
fis.close();
}
}
```
步骤二:数据存储到数据库
将Excel文件中的数据存储到数据库中,以便于后续在JSP页面中展示。这里我们以MySQL为例。
1. 创建数据库和表
```sql
CREATE DATABASE mydb;
USE mydb;
CREATE TABLE mytable (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(255),
age INT
);
```
2. 添加数据库连接
在你的Java项目中添加以下依赖:
```xml
```
接下来,编写一个Java类来连接数据库:
```java
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class DBConnection {
public static Connection getConnection() {
String url = "







